Mandy Houghton was totally taken by surprise when diagnosed with cancer at her first routine colonoscopy at age 50. Since then, she’s been on a mission to educate others about routine screenings and knowing your family’s history. Oh, and she’s not afraid to talk about poop or farts nowadays. She has been married 25 years and has three adult children.

Kari Moncrief was diagnosed with breast cancer at a routine mammogram right after her 50th birthday. She was an educator for 12 years before moving from Louisiana to Raleigh. Now she works for the non-profit Western Wake Tennis sharing her love of tennis. She has been married to her hubby Jeff for 23 years and they have 2 children, a junior in HS and a sophomore in college. She loves playing tennis, spending time at the family’s mountain home and going on adventures with her family.
